Tangent is back with a new limited series hosted by Edward Cohen & Jeffrey Berman (Partner at Camber Creek). In this episode, we introduce the series' main themes, including how Proptech leaders are improving our cities and quality of life, how will the remote work revolution reshape our cities and impact Real Estate valuations, the Great Tech Correction (don't call it Dotcom 2.0) and how we can tackle the Housing supply and affordability crisis. We will examine these topics through diverse frames, including founders, venture capitalists, real estate investors, public sector leaders and media and academia experts.
